Prayer, Fasting, and Giving

Jesus speaks to these three spiritual practices in Matthew 6:1-21.  They are highlighted on Ash Wednesday and have been the primary spiritual practices encouraged by the church as a means to focus and grow during this 40 Day season (minus Sundays).

Prayer

Picture
For Adults: St. Ignatian's Daily Examen. 
With this practice, you are invited to review your day in prayer and reflect on how and where God acted.
